Chicken (or Veal Chops) With Olives, Capers and Sage Recipe

Ingredients:

20 fresh sage leaves
2 tbs olive oil
3 pieces meat
3 garlic cloves, minced
1 C dry wine
2 C chicken stock
1 C imported black or green olives, pitted and coarsely chopped
1/4 C capers, drained
2 tbs chopped fresh sage
1 tbs lemon juice

Directions:

Warm olive oil over medium high heat. When hot add sage leaves and cook until crisp, 30-60 seconds. Drain and reserve leaves. Add meat and brown both sides. Transfer to a platter and cover. Add garlic, cook until soft. Add white wine and simmer until almost evaporated then add chicken stock and reduce by half. Add olives, capers and chopped sage and stir together. Add lemon juice and salt and pepper to taste.
Serve over meat.
